About Event

From Conversation to Creation

What happens when AI becomes part of your creative thinking — not as a generator, but as a collaborator?

In this session, we’ll explore how ideas turn into decisions through a hands-on fashion design experiment.

What this is:
A curated salon + hands-on experiment.
We’ll use fashion design as a medium to explore taste, judgment, and decision-making with AI in the loop.

What this is NOT:
This is not a fashion class.
This is not an AI demo.
No drawing or design experience is required.

What we’ll do together:

  • Start with a small set of curated fashion references to ground the discussion

  • Use AI as a thinking partner to explore ideas and trade-offs

  • Create a simple outfit concept through sketching, notes, or collage

  • Share and reflect on where judgment mattered most

What’s included:

  • All materials provided

  • Light refreshments

  • A small, intentional group

This session is for:

  • Engineers, builders, and researchers curious about taste and judgment

  • Artists and designers interested in decision-making, not aesthetics alone

  • Anyone curious about how AI shapes creative thinking
